Factors Affecting Price

When it comes to roofing, several elements play into the final bill. The type of materials, size and complexity of your roof, and even the time of year can all influence the cost.

Material Matters Roofing materials are not created equal. Asphalt shingles, the most common choice, are generally more affordable. However, if you’re looking for longevity, metal or tile roofs, though pricier, might be better investments in the long run. Each material has its own price point, lifespan, and maintenance requirements.

Size and Complexity The size of your roof is a straightforward cost factor: larger roofs require more materials and more labor. But don’t overlook complexity. Features like skylights, chimneys, and steep slopes can complicate the job, leading to higher costs.

Extra Expenses

There are often additional costs that aren’t immediately obvious. These can include old roof removal, waste disposal, and unexpected repairs once the old materials are stripped away.

Permits and Inspections In Slidell, LA, you’ll likely need a permit to replace your roof, which adds to the cost. Inspections, necessary for ensuring your new roof meets local building codes, also come with their own fees.

Insurance Considerations

Your homeowner’s insurance might influence your roofing costs, particularly if your roof replacement is due to damage covered by your policy. This can be a complex area, so it’s worth discussing with your insurance provider.
